The slope of a line is 1/3.
What is the slope of a line perpendicular to this line?

Respuesta :

honeykarma
honeykarma honeykarma
  • 08-03-2021

Answer:

-3

Step-by-step explanation:

Slopes of a perpendicular line are the opposite reciprocal.

So, the opposite of 1/3 is -1/3.

Then the reciprocal of -1/3 is -3 (since -3 is -3/1).
